By John-Paul Boyd ( March 14, 2018, 8:37 AM EDT) -- People who are polyamorous are, or prefer to be, involved in more than one intimate relationship at a time. Some polyamorists are involved in stable, long-term loving relationships involving two or more other people. Others are simultaneously engaged in a number of relationships of varying degrees of permanence and commitment. Still others are involved in a web of concurrent relationships which range from short-term relationships that are purely sexual in nature to more enduring relationships characterized by deep emotional attachments....
